About 2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id
2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id (PubChem CID 4962880) has the molecular formula C10H12N4O2S
and a molecular weight of 252.30 g/mol. Its IUPAC name is 2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id.

What is the SMILES notation for 2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id?
The canonical SMILES for 2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id is CSc1nc2nc(C)c(CC(=O)O)c(C)n2n1.
What is the InChIKey of 2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id?
The InChIKey is AFWKTHVGDRIPLU-UHFFFAOYSA-N. The full InChI is InChI=1S/C10H12N4O2S/c1-5-7(4-8(15)16)6(2)14-9(11-5)12-10(13-14)17-3/h4H2,1-3H3,(H,15,16).
What are the key properties of 2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id?
2-(5,7-dimethyl-2-methylsulfanyl-[1,2,4]triazolo[1,5-a]pyrimidin-6-yl)acetic acid has a molecular weight of 252.30 g/mol, XLogP of 1.09, 3 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
